Mount Washington, NH. The tallest mountain in the Northeast! Mt. Washington towers over its neighbors at an elevation of 6,288ft. It is known for erratic weather and extremely strong winds - even in the summer - and falling snow isn't unheard of in July. A summer ascent of Mt. Washington is a bucket-list hike!

About. Mt. Washington Alpine Resort is a year-round recreation destination located on Vancouver Island, British Columbia. In the winter guests enjoy accessing over 1,700 acres and 505 vertical metres of alpine terrain, 55kms of cross-country skiing and 25kms of snowshoeing trails along with a dedicated Nordic lodge, Tube Park and Fat Bike trails.

The backcountry skier who died on New Hampshire’s …Aug 2, 2023 · The Tuckerman Ravine Trail is heralded as the easiest and most popular way to hike to the Mt. Washington summit. The trailhead is located at the Pinkham Notch Visitor Center on Route 16. Length: 7.6 miles roundtrip. Elevation Gain: 4,255 feet. Mt Washington Tuckerman Ravine Trail Elevation Chart. Standing at 6,288 feet, Mount Washington is the highest mountain in New England's White Mountains, which span through Vermont, New Hampshire, and Maine. It is the most prominent mountain east of the Mississippi River. Famous for it's harsh and unpredictable winter weather and it's record setting wind gusts, Mount Washington was actually ranked the eighth most dangerous mountain in the world by ...
